Road Numbers With P4 #MathsWeekScot

P4 hit the road but more with Numberjacks than Jack this week. As part of our work for maths week scotland we were surveying traffic in Dalry.

We were counting different vehicles, vehicles per minute and comparing volumes of traffic.

Maybe you could carry this on on walks to school or the shops? How many cars on the way to the shops and from the shops? Which is bigger?

P4/5 Maths in the Wild #MathsWeekScot

P4/5 went down to the woods for Maths Week Scotland.

They found lots of maths when we sent them on the maths hunt amongst the trees.

There was leaf symmetry, twig counting, twig sums, branch weight and mass, tree ring age counting, and counting spots on leaves.

After the hunt we built number tic tac toe games by making 5 twig bundles to build numbers 1-9.
